Content Hub is a platform for content marketing and social media operations. Its core idea is to turn content into reusable assets and distribute them across different online channels. It is not a typical keyword research or technical SEO tool; it is closer to a combined tool for content inspiration aggregation, social media calendars, content version management, scheduling, and KPI tracking.
The platform supports subscribing to any RSS or Atom news feed, and can also combine Twitter, Instagram, and YouTube channels into a news stream for generating content ideas. Its social media calendar includes hundreds of holidays and social media events throughout the year, along with images and hashtags, making it useful for day-to-day content operations. Content can be adapted into multiple versions for different platforms—for example, shorter copy for Twitter or different images for Facebook—and users can view schedules for platforms such as Facebook, Twitter, and LinkedIn. For KPIs, users can track crawler-accessible metrics such as Facebook likes, Twitter followers, app downloads, and revenue. Paid plans provide an API for accessing and modifying content and integrating it into workflows.
The pricing structure is straightforward: Basic is free forever and includes 1 project, 1 user, 5 aggregation sources, and 3 KPIs, but it does not include API access and requires a backlink; Starter is $19/month; Pro is $79/month; Ultimate is $149/month. The main differences between plans are the allowances for projects, users, aggregation sources, KPIs, and support options.
Its strengths are that it covers the basic content operations loop from inspiration, calendar planning, versioning, and scheduling to performance tracking, while also offering a permanently free plan with a low barrier to entry. Its drawbacks are that the site does not show dedicated SEO capabilities such as keyword databases, rank tracking, backlink analysis, or site audits. Payment methods, security and compliance details, and data coverage scale are also not sufficiently disclosed. The free plan has fairly noticeable limitations.
It is suitable for small and medium-sized businesses, social media operators, content marketing teams, and teams publishing content across multiple projects. If the goal is in-depth Google SEO analysis, it is better used as a content operations aid rather than a core SEO platform.
Access from China appears to be partially restricted. The site does not clearly state whether it can be accessed directly from mainland China, but its core channels involve overseas platforms such as Twitter, Instagram, YouTube, and Facebook, so actual usage will depend on the user’s network environment. USD subscription payment methods are also not disclosed. Domestic alternatives to consider include 新榜, 微小宝, WeChat Official Account backend tools, WeCom tools, or local social media management platforms.
